Located close to Alton Water, which is renowned for its sailing facilities and walks, is this well-presented four bedroom detached bungalow which is set on a corner plot, just four miles from Manningtree railway station.

The reception hall has doors off to all accommodation. The sitting room has a dual aspect outlook overlooking the garden. There is a feature fireplace with fitted gas fire. To the front of the sitting room there are double doors to a dining room and to the rear are double doors onto a garden room with a triple aspect outlook overlooking the rear garden.

Overlooking the garden is a contemporary kitchen/breakfast room. This is equipped with a extensive range of base units, wall cupboards, work tops and drawers. Integrated appliances include a four ring induction hob with extractor over, double electric oven, microwave, dishwasher and a fridge. There is a separate utility room which has further storage along with plumbing and space for white goods.

A cloakroom comprises a WC and basin. There are four generous size bedrooms. The main bedroom has two windows to the side and an array of built-in bedroom furniture. Adjacent to this is a modernised en-suite comprising a double shower, basin with storage below and a WC.

The second bedroom, which is a good size double room, is located to the front. Bedrooms three and four are also double bedrooms with bedroom three being located to the rear with wall-to-wall built-in wardrobes and bedroom four located to the front.

There is a large family bathroom comprising a bath, separate double shower, WC and basin.

Outside
To the front and sides of the property is a substanital garden laid partly to lawn with a hedge and picket fence border. The driveway, which is laid to brick paviers, provides parking. This leads to a single garage with an electric roller door. The garage has French doors to the rear, eaves storage and light/power connected.

The rear garden is predominantly laid to lawn with an extensive range of flower beds, shrubs and a patio area. There is a summerhouse and a vergetable plot to the side.

The overall plot measures around 0.225 acres.
